To get permission to use images from the internet, always start by checking the image's copyright status. You can use Creative Commons licenses or other freely available sources such as stock photo sites that explicitly allow usage. If in doubt, contact the image owner for explicit permission to use the photo. Always credit the source properly as per their requirements.

- How can I check if an image is free to use? You can check the image's copyright status by looking for Creative Commons licenses, usage rights on stock photo sites, or contacting the owner directly.
- What is the safest way to use images from the internet? The safest way is to use images licensed for reuse, such as those under Creative Commons, or to get explicit permission from the copyright holder.
- Do I need to credit the source when using an image? Yes, always credit the source as required by the image license or permission you obtained to legally use the image.
